Turinys:

„IoT Smart Socket Arduino & Cayenne“: 5 žingsniai (su nuotraukomis)
„IoT Smart Socket Arduino & Cayenne“: 5 žingsniai (su nuotraukomis)

Video: „IoT Smart Socket Arduino & Cayenne“: 5 žingsniai (su nuotraukomis)

Video: „IoT Smart Socket Arduino & Cayenne“: 5 žingsniai (su nuotraukomis)
Video: Arduino Cayenne IoT Socket 2024, Liepa
Anonim
„IoT Smart Socket Arduino“ir „Cayenne“
„IoT Smart Socket Arduino“ir „Cayenne“

Pamačiau kinišką lizdą, kurį galite valdyti telefonu, bet aš esu kūrėjas ir noriu tik pats tai padaryti!

Tai įmanoma naudojant CAYENNE prietaisų skydelį!

Ar pažįsti Kajeną? Žiūrėkite Cayenne svetainę!

Bendra projekto vertė yra apie 60 000 USD

ATKREIPK DĖMESĮ

Šis projektas naudoja AUKŠTĄ ĮTempimą

Aš naudoju įprastus lizdo komponentus ir „Arduino MKR1000“. Dabar galiu įjungti ir išjungti du lizdus savo namuose, kai tik noriu, ir bet kurioje pasaulio vietoje, naudodamas savo išmanųjį telefoną ar kitą pasaulio kompiuterį, pvz., „Internet Point PC“Bankoke:-)

1 žingsnis: medžiagos

Medžiagos
Medžiagos
Medžiagos
Medžiagos
Medžiagos
Medžiagos

Bendra projekto vertė yra apie 60 000 USD. Medžiagos galima įsigyti „Amazon“arba vietinėje parduotuvėje.

„Amazon“galite įsigyti „Arduino MKR1000“ir kitus elektronikos komponentus, o lizdo komponentus - vietinėje parduotuvėje. Italijoje buitiniam prietaisui yra 220 V kintamosios srovės srovė. Dėl šios priežasties lizdai yra tokios formos. Galite naudoti vietinį lizdą ir vietinius kintamosios srovės komponentus.

„Arduino“ir relės lizdo komponentai yra šie:

  • „Arduino MKR1000“
  • PCB arba 0 USD, 69 USD „GearBest“
  • „Stripline“jungtys, skirtos „Arduino MKR1000“(galiu atjungti „Arduino MKR1000“nuo PCB)
  • 3 x 220 omų rezistoriai arba 2 USD, 41 USD „GearBest“
  • 3 x LED (raudona, mėlyna, mėlyna) arba 4,08 USD „GearBest“
  • Nuolatinė 5 V min. 1,5 A maitinimo šaltinis arba 2 USD, 41 USD „GearBest“
  • Relės skydas su 2 relėmis arba 1 USD, 5 USD „GearBest“
  • „Arduino“laidai arba 2 USD, 20 USD „GearBest“

Vietinėje elektronikos parduotuvėje galite nusipirkti 220 arba 110 voltų komponentų.

Galite surinkti visus komponentus ir atidaryti angą „Arduino MKR1000“USB kabeliui. Atlikdami šią procedūrą, galite užprogramuoti „Arduino“neatidarę lizdo dėklo. Eskizą galite atnaujinti arba keisti bet kada.

2 žingsnis: teorija ir praktika

Image
Image

Vaizdo įraše galiu paaiškinti projektą. Galite naudoti „Arduino MKR1000“ar daugelį kitų skydų, tokių kaip ESP8266 ir kt. Atkreipkite dėmesį į relių galios ribas. Mano lizdo galia vatais yra 10A, 220V - apie 2200W. Taip, galiu naudoti plaukų džiovintuvą …

Sudėkite ir išbandykite relės skydą naudodami mirksėjimo kodą.

ATKREIPKITE DĖMESĮ! Šis projektas naudoja AUKŠTĄ ĮTempimą

Raskite mirksėjimo kodą „Arduino IDE“. Spustelėkite Failų pavyzdžių pagrindai mirksi. Naudokite kaiščius, turinčius relių ekraną, ir pamatysite, kaip mirksi šviesos diodas ir relė. Mano atveju, kaiščiai yra 7 ir 8. Nenaudokite kaiščio numerio 6. Šis kaištis yra prijungtas prie vieno rezistoriaus ir prie borto. Jei mirksėjimo kodas veikia, galite pereiti prie kito veiksmo.

Galite užprogramuoti „Arduino“naudodami create.arduino.cc

3 žingsnis: sukurkite „Cayenne“prietaisų skydelį

Sukurkite „Cayenne“prietaisų skydelį
Sukurkite „Cayenne“prietaisų skydelį
Sukurkite „Cayenne“prietaisų skydelį
Sukurkite „Cayenne“prietaisų skydelį

Galite užsiregistruoti „Cayenne“naudodami „Cayenne My Device“ir savo prietaisų skydelyje sukurti naują įrenginį. Sukūrę įrenginį, turite įvesti „Arduino IDE“prieigos rakto kodą. Atkreipkite dėmesį į „Token“, „Cayenne“puslapyje, ir kitame žingsnyje įdėkite kodą į „Arduino“eskizą.

Ženklas skiriasi, nes prie „Cayenne“prietaisų skydelio galite prijungti daug įrenginių. Taip pat galite naudoti, pavyzdžiui, įvestį iš „Arduino UNO“įrenginio ir kitą valdiklį iš „Arduino MKR1000“ir sudėti į „Cayenne Project“puslapį. Galimybių yra daug!

Įkraukite savo lentos kodą atlikdami kitą veiksmą. Jūs laukiate „Arduino MKR1000“prijungimo prie „Cayenne“debesies ir įdėję skaitmeninį valdiklį į savo prietaisų skydelį. Aš naudoju „Arduino“kaiščius 7 ir 8.

Dabar „Cayenne“yra beta versija MQTT protokolui. Sekite naujienas

4 veiksmas: įdiekite biblioteką ir įkelkite kodą

Įdiekite biblioteką ir įkelkite kodą
Įdiekite biblioteką ir įkelkite kodą

Dabar galite įdiegti „Cayenne Arduino“biblioteką ir įkelti kodą iš „Arduino IDE“.

Galite sekti bibliotekų diegimo vadovėlį.

Įkeliamas kodas yra paprastesnis. Atidarykite kodo pavyzdį naudodami failo pavyzdį „Cayenne Internet Connections Arduino MKR1000“ir pakeiskite savo LAN SSID ir LAN slaptažodį. Įdėję „Cayenne“prietaisų skydelio žetoną (žr. Ankstesnį žingsnį).

Taip pat galite naudoti naują „Arduino IDE“debesį:

5 žingsnis: peržiūrėkite rezultatus

Image
Image

Atlikę šiuos veiksmus, galite valdyti lizdą naudodami „Cayenne“programą arba kompiuterį.

Sukurkite arba pakeiskite šį projektą. Dalinkitės, like ir prenumeruokite. Gera vieta pradėti naudotis „Cayenne“yra Kajeno bendruomenės forumas

Rekomenduojamas: